What is The Adirondack Soaring Association? The Adirondack Soaring Association is a group of (60) licensed glider pilots, power pilots, certified instructors, and student pilots that fly sailplanes at Saratoga County Airport. These aircraft are not tube and fabric hang-gliders but are rigid wing, fully certified sailplanes that can weigh 1,000 pounds or more. Sailplanes are towed aloft by a powered aircraft then released at approximately 2,000 feet. The sailplane flight can be as short as 15 minutes, but flights as long as 10 hours have been accomplished. The club currently has 8 FAA certified glider flight instructors, 3 FAA power flight instructors, and 8 towpilots |

The club operates primarily on weekends and most holidays, April 1st through November 25th from 10:00AM to Sunset. The Club's current base of operation is Saratoga County Airport, in Saratoga Springs, New York. |
